BBSM holds meet in Curchorem

CURCHOREM: At a public meeting at Curchorem on Saturday, the Bharatiya Bhasha Suraksha Manch (BBSM) leaders have condemned the State government for fooling Goans on Medium of Instruction issue. BBSM criticised the government for giving grants to English primary schools run by the Diocesan Society.

BBSM issued an ultimatum to the government to stop grants to English medium primary schools by Gandhi Jayanti.

Pandurang Nadkarni opined that primary level education in mother tongue is very important for development of the child. He said the BJP government should stop grants to English medium primary schools.

Fr Ataide said the government should give grants to only government primary schools, which are Konkani or Marathi and not English medium primary schools. Nagesh Karmali said that if the government doesn't stop grants then it will face the consequences in the upcoming assembly election. Subhas Velingkar said the government is playing with the sentiments of the people on MoI issue.
